[Asia Economy Reporter Hwang Sumi] A man in his 50s who sexually assaulted his stepdaughter for 12 years was sentenced to 25 years in prison. It was reported that he committed the crimes starting when his stepdaughter was a minor, at the age of 9.


On the 27th, the 11th Criminal Division of Jeonju District Court (Chief Judge Kang Dongwon) sentenced Mr. A (54), who was indicted for violating the Act on Special Cases Concerning the Punishment, etc. of Sexual Crimes (rape of a minor under 13) and other charges, to 25 years in prison.


Mr. A was tried on charges of continuously sexually assaulting the victim, his stepdaughter Ms. B, from 2009 when she was 9 years old until 2021, spanning approximately 12 years.


According to legal sources, since 2002, Mr. A had been the stepfather to Ms. B and her siblings, including Ms. B’s mother Ms. C, caring for two sons and one daughter. Later, Mr. A and Ms. C had four children together, raising a total of seven children.


However, Mr. A exercised violence against the family members including Ms. B, and especially harassed and assaulted Ms. B severely.


During this time, Mr. A threatened that if Ms. B refused his demands, he would kill the entire family or sexually assault her younger sister.


In 2009, when Ms. B was 9 years old and sleeping at home, Mr. A approached her and sexually assaulted her, saying, "Be quiet. I’m doing this because I love you." From then until August 2021, it was confirmed that he sexually assaulted or forcibly molested her a total of 343 times.


As a result, Ms. B became pregnant at the age of 14 and had to undergo an abortion, and during the years of abuse, pregnancy and abortion occurred once more.


But Mr. A’s crimes did not stop there. He installed a location tracking app on Ms. B’s cellphone to monitor her so she could not meet other men.


Mr. A also threatened Ms. B, saying, "You are pregnant with my child, so you are my wife. Act like my wife," and "If you meet another man, I will kill you."


This case came to light when the victim, Ms. B, who had become an adult, confided in an acquaintance about Mr. A’s crimes in August of this year.


The court stated, "The defendant overpowered the victim with violence, mercilessly hitting her cheeks to the point that she lost consciousness when she refused sexual relations, and then raped her. The victim’s biological mother neglected this," and added, "Due to these crimes, the victim became pregnant twice and underwent abortions, including the first pregnancy at age 14."


Furthermore, "The victim was too afraid of retaliation to seek help and had to endure physical and mental suffering alone," and "Although the victim pleaded for severe punishment of the defendant, she still lives in fear that the defendant might retaliate against her if released," the court added.



The court explained the sentencing rationale, saying, "Although the defendant admitted wrongdoing and has no prior record of similar offenses or punishments exceeding fines, the crimes in this case are so horrific that they are difficult to even mention or recall," and "Considering the lifelong physical and psychological damage inflicted on the victim, a heavy sentence is inevitable."
